The Disaster Resilience Days, event organised under CERIS (Community for European Research and Innovation for Security) brings together experts, policymakers, and innovators from across Europe and beyond to discuss disaster resilience, preparedness, and technological advancements in crisis response and preparedness.  This multi-day conference features keynote presentations from the European Commission and Member States, insightful panel discussions, live demonstrations of cutting-edge projects, and opportunities for collaboration.

Key topics include innovation in disaster resilience and preparedness, community engagement, secure communication, space technologies, and international cooperation, as well as demo sessions showcasing groundbreaking projects. Additionally, a walking exhibition of projects provide a platform for professionals to connect and exchange ideas. Disaster Resilience Days is a unique opportunity to fosters cross-sector collaborations and drives forward actionable solutions to enhance disaster preparedness and resilience.
